Our first 'Volunteer of the Month" is Glenys Stade
Glenys has be volunteering as the "Front of House Manager" for 6 years and in other roles for 28 years!
Glenys was a Cali girl who wanted to remain involved in the sport after retiring from competing, so she began volunteering as she wanted to give back to the sport which had given so much to her.
Do you get any benefit from volunteering?
"There is a real pleasure in staying involved and spending time with others who share the love of the sport."
Is there a part of volunteering that you really enjoy?
"Catching up with the people I have got to know over the years."
What do you love doing/what are you passionate about?
"I am an organised person and I am glad that my skills can be put to good use in helping to run a competition. There is a real sense of joy when everything runs smoothly and you know you have had a part in that success."
Thank you Glenys for your ongoing efforts for our sport.
